| Platform Configuration Database (PCD) PPI defined in PI 1.2 Vol3 | |
| A platform database that contains a variety of current platform settings or | |
| directives that can be accessed by a driver or application. | |
| PI PCD ppi only provide the accessing interfaces for Dynamic-Ex type PCD. | |
| This is the base PCD service API that provides an abstraction for accessing configuration content in | |
| the platform. It a seamless mechanism for extracting information regardless of where the | |
| information is stored (such as in Read-only data, or an EFI Variable). | |
| This protocol allows access to data through size-granular APIs and provides a mechanism for a | |
| firmware component to monitor specific settings and be alerted when a setting is changed. | |

| /** | |
| SetSku() sets the SKU Id to be used for subsequent calls to set or get PCD values. SetSku() is | |
| normally called only once by the system. | |
| For each item (token), the database can hold a single value that applies to all SKUs, or multiple | |
| values, where each value is associated with a specific SKU Id. Items with multiple, SKU-specific | |
| values are called SKU enabled. | |
| The SKU Id of zero is reserved as a default. The valid SkuId range is 1 to 255. For tokens that are | |
| not SKU enabled, the system ignores any set SKU Id and works with the single value for that token. | |
| For SKU-enabled tokens, the system will use the SKU Id set by the last call to SetSku(). If no | |
| SKU Id is set or the currently set SKU Id isn't valid for the specified token, the system uses the | |
| default SKU Id. If the system attempts to use the default SKU Id and no value has been set for that | |
| Id, the results are unpredictable. | |
| @param[in] SkuId The SKU value to set. | |
| **/ | |
| typedef | |
| VOID | |
| (EFIAPI *EFI_PEI_PCD_PPI_SET_SKU)( | |
| IN UINTN SkuId | |
| ); | |

| /** | |
| Retrieves the next valid PCD token for a given namespace. | |
| This provides a means by which to get the next valid token number in a given namespace. This is | |
| useful since the PCD infrastructure has a sparse list of token numbers in it, and one cannot a priori | |
| know what token numbers are valid in the database. | |
| @param[in] Guid The 128-bit unique value that designates which namespace to extract the value from. | |
| @param[in] TokenNumber A pointer to the PCD token number to use to find the subsequent token number. To | |
| retrieve the "first" token, have the pointer reference a TokenNumber value of 0. | |
| @retval EFI_SUCCESS The PCD service has retrieved the value requested. | |
| @retval EFI_NOT_FOUND The PCD service could not find data from the requested token number. | |
| **/ | |
| typedef | |
| EFI_STATUS | |
| (EFIAPI *EFI_PEI_PCD_PPI_GET_NEXT_TOKEN)( | |
| IN CONST EFI_GUID *Guid OPTIONAL, | |
| IN UINTN *TokenNumber | |
| ); | |
